WebWorking out the scale . A scale is shown as a ratio, for example 1:100. A drawing at a scale of 1:100 means that the object is 100 times smaller than in real life scale 1:1. You could also say, 1 unit in the drawing is equal to 100 units in real life. ... When working in CAD you can let the software do some of the hard work for you by making ... WebJul 9, 2024 · How Gearing Ratios Work If your company had $100,000 in debt, and your balance sheet showed $75,000 of shareholders' or owners' equity, then your gearing ratio would be about 133%, which is generally considered high.
